Coral Banks

2001-5C | valspar | HEX: #D88E8B | RGB: 216, 142, 139

Undertones of Valspar Coral Banks

Coral Banks is a rich coral infused with soft orange and pink undertones, creating a dynamic balance between warmth and freshness. The orange undertones provide a cheerful, sunlit energy, while the pink hints add a touch of softness and elegance. These undertones make the shade adaptable, allowing it to play beautifully with both neutral and bold color schemes.

This color leans warmer, making it an excellent choice for spaces that benefit from a cozy yet vibrant atmosphere. It feels inviting during the day under natural light, and under softer, ambient lighting, Coral Banks takes on a more subdued, sophisticated look.


Coordinating Colors

To create a harmonious and well-balanced palette, pair Coral Banks with complementary or coordinating colors. Here are some excellent options:

  1. Whites and Creams

    • Valspar Swiss Coffee (7002-16): A soft, creamy white that balances Coral Banks’ vibrancy, creating an airy and timeless look.
    • Valspar Ivory Dust (7003-6): For a touch of warmth, this neutral ivory adds depth without competing with Coral Banks.
  2. Blues and Greens

    • Valspar Sea Air (5006-9C): A light, breezy blue that creates a refreshing beachy vibe when paired with Coral Banks.
    • Valspar Spring Sprout (6003-4A): A muted green that complements the coral tones, perfect for creating a nature-inspired palette.
  3. Grays and Charcoals

    • Valspar Gravity (4005-1B): A cool gray that grounds Coral Banks’ energy, making it ideal for modern or industrial settings.
    • Valspar Rugged Suede (4006-2A): A deeper charcoal that adds drama and sophistication to the coral hue.
  4. Metallics

    • Gold and brass accents work beautifully with Coral Banks, enhancing the warmth and adding a luxurious touch.
    • Silver or brushed nickel tones can provide a sleek, contemporary edge.

Best Uses for Valspar Coral Banks

Coral Banks is extremely versatile and can be used in a variety of settings to evoke different moods. Here are some ideas for incorporating this vibrant shade into your home or workspace:

Accent Walls

Coral Banks makes a bold statement as an accent wall in living rooms, bedrooms, or dining areas. Pair it with neutral walls in cream or gray to keep the focus on its lively hue without overwhelming the space. An accent wall in Coral Banks can completely reinvigorate a room, making it feel brighter and more dynamic.

Kitchen and Dining Areas

This coral shade is a fantastic choice for kitchens or dining rooms. Its warm undertones stimulate energy and appetite, making it a popular choice for spaces where people gather. Pair it with white cabinetry and gold hardware for a fresh, modern look.

Nurseries and Kids' Rooms

The playful pink and orange undertones make Coral Banks ideal for children’s spaces. It creates a cheerful atmosphere without being overly bold. Combine it with soft blues, greens, or whites for a balanced and soothing aesthetic.

Bathrooms

For a spa-like retreat or coastal-inspired bathroom, Coral Banks pairs beautifully with white subway tiles, brushed nickel fixtures, and pops of aqua or teal. The coral hue adds warmth and personality to a typically neutral space.

Outdoor Spaces

This vibrant coral shade can also shine outdoors. Use Coral Banks for patio furniture, planters, or even an accent wall in an outdoor seating area to create a lively and inviting atmosphere.


Styling Tips for Coral Banks

  • Texture: Enhance the impact of Coral Banks by incorporating textural elements such as woven baskets, natural wood furniture, or patterned textiles. These grounding elements allow the coral to shine without feeling overwhelming.
  • Artwork: Complement Coral Banks with artwork that incorporates similar colors. Pieces featuring coastal landscapes, abstract designs, or botanical themes will tie the room together beautifully.
  • Lighting: Since Coral Banks can shift slightly depending on lighting, experiment with warm and cool-toned light bulbs to determine how best to highlight its undertones in your space.
